Mission

The Early Music in Higher Education Committee is a standing committee of Early Music America whose mission is to promote and nurture early music performance programs at North American colleges and universities, to help EMA serve collegium directors and others involved in early music performance in higher education, and to facilitate exchange of ideas among early music educators. The membership of the committee consists of individuals active in early music performance instruction either as directors of ensembles or as studio teachers.
